Job summary
Job post source
This job is directly from iHeartMedia
Job overview
The Staff Backend Software Engineer at iHeartMedia leads backend platform development, focusing on scalable, secure, and maintainable systems to support core services.
Responsibilities and impact
The role involves designing and maintaining microservices using Scala, Java, Golang, or Kotlin, architecting solutions on Kubernetes and AWS, leading complex projects, working with various databases, setting engineering best practices, collaborating cross-functionally, mentoring engineers, and participating in on-call duties.
Compensation and benefits
The salary range is $144,000 to $180,000, with flexible benefits including medical, dental, vision, life insurance, paid time off, holidays, 401K, employee assistance programs, and additional voluntary benefits.
Experience and skills
Candidates need 8+ years of backend engineering experience including 2+ years in a staff/principal role, proficiency in at least two backend languages, strong Kubernetes and AWS knowledge, experience with SQL and NoSQL databases, technical leadership, monitoring tools experience, and excellent communication skills; event-driven architecture experience is a plus.
Career development
The position offers opportunities for technical leadership, mentorship, and working on large-scale backend systems, fostering growth in a collaborative, innovative environment.
Work environment and culture
iHeartMedia values diversity, collaboration, curiosity, respect, and inclusivity, promoting a welcoming and supportive team environment.
Company information
iHeartMedia is America's leading audio company with a vast audience reach, top-rated markets, the largest podcast publisher, and a comprehensive audio ad technology stack, known for popular live music events and digital streaming services.
Team overview
The candidate will join the backend platform team, working closely with frontend, data, DevOps, and product teams in a collaborative setting.
Job location and travel
The position is based in New York, NY, at 125 West 55th Street, with full-time, salaried employment.
Application process
Applications are accepted on an ongoing basis with no specific deadlines mentioned; candidates are encouraged to apply even if not perfectly aligned with qualifications.
Unique job features
The role offers the chance to work with multiple backend languages, cloud-native infrastructure, microservices, and cutting-edge technologies like Kubernetes, AWS, and observability tools, with a focus on technical ownership and innovation.
Company overview
iHeartMedia, Inc. is a leading global media and entertainment company specializing in radio broadcasting, digital streaming, and live events. They generate revenue through advertising sales across their extensive network of radio stations, digital platforms, and events. Founded in 1972 as Clear Channel Communications, the company rebranded to iHeartMedia in 2014 to reflect its focus on digital and mobile media. Noteworthy for its iHeartRadio app, the company has a significant presence in the digital audio space, offering both live radio and on-demand content.
How to land this job
Tailor your resume to showcase extensive backend engineering experience, particularly highlighting your proficiency in Scala, Java, Golang, and Kotlin, as these are critical for the Staff Backend Software Engineer role at iHeartMedia.
Emphasize your expertise in designing and deploying microservices within Kubernetes and AWS environments, along with your experience managing SQL and NoSQL databases like PostgreSQL, MongoDB, and DynamoDB, to align with the job's technical demands.
Apply through multiple channels including iHeartMedia's official corporate careers page and LinkedIn to maximize your visibility and increase your chances of being noticed by recruiters.
Connect on LinkedIn with engineers and managers in iHeartMedia's backend or platform teams; open conversations with ice breakers such as asking about recent technical challenges they faced, commenting on iHeartMedia's audio technology innovations, or expressing enthusiasm about their cloud-native infrastructure.
Optimize your resume for ATS by incorporating keywords from the job description such as 'microservices,' 'Kubernetes,' 'AWS,' 'Scala,' 'Java,' 'Golang,' 'Kotlin,' 'PostgreSQL,' 'MongoDB,' 'DynamoDB,' and 'technical leadership' to ensure it passes automated screenings effectively.
Use Jennie Johnson's Power Apply feature to automate tailoring your resume, identify the best application portals, and find relevant LinkedIn contacts to network with, allowing you to focus your energy on preparing for interviews and refining your skills.
Jennie Johnson works for you!
Here’s what we do to make sure you’re successful:
Targeted Resume Revamp:
We expertly craft your resume to navigate Applicant Tracking Systems (ATS) and showcase your qualifications, making you stand out as a top-tier candidate.
Job Description Dissection:
Unpack the job posting with expert analysis, ensuring your application hits every key requirement.
Bespoke Cover Letter:
Capture the attention of hiring managers with a personalized cover letter that highlights how your skills align perfectly with the job's needs.
Interview Mastery:
Prepare for interviews like a pro with likely questions, strategic answers, and insightful questions for you to ask, setting you apart as an informed candidate.
Direct Application Insights:
Receive tailored advice on the best places to apply, ensuring your applications are seen by the right employers.
Skills and Gaps Assessment:
Identify and close critical skills gaps to position yourself as the best-fit candidate for your ideal job.
Personalized Email Pitch:
Make a memorable first impression with an email template crafted to engage potential employers and initiate meaningful conversations.
In-depth Research Guide:
Leverage comprehensive research tools to gather effective insights on companies, industry trends, and role-specific challenges.
Detailed Company Analysis:
Gain in-depth understanding of your prospective employer, giving you the edge in applications and interviews.
Strategic Candidate Overview:
Understand your unique value and why companies would want to interview you, highlighting your background and positioning.